1. Multi-Compartment Bookshelves & Toy Racks
Books, toys, and hobby materials can easily create clutter in a child’s room.
- Open MDF shelving systems offer easy access for kids.
- Colorful MDF finishes match the playful energy of the room.
2. MDF Beds with Built-In Storage
Drawer or lift-up style MDF beds provide extra storage for toys or clothes.
- Under-bed drawers are a great space-saver for compact rooms.
- Helps reduce clutter and promotes organization.
3. Desk + Shelf Combo Units
Every child needs a dedicated study area.
- MDF-integrated desk and shelf systems are ideal for both homework and book storage.
- Can include top shelving and bottom compartments for stationery.
4. Foldable Play Tables
Play is essential—but space is limited.
- Foldable MDF play tables save room when not in use.
- Kid-friendly, colorful, and scratch-resistant surfaces.
5. Multi-Function MDF Wardrobes
Storage for clothes, school bags, and toys should be functional and accessible.
- Combine shelves, hanging space, and drawers in one MDF unit.
- Rounded corners and handle-free doors enhance child safety.
